Asphalt Content Tester for Asphalt Mixtures
This laboratory instrument determines the asphalt content in asphalt mixtures. The tester uses the ignition method to measure the asphalt content by burning off the asphalt binder and determining the weight loss.

High-Efficiency Combustion Testing
The Asphalt Content Tester is a specialized laboratory instrument designed for the precise determination of asphalt content in mixtures using the combustion method. This environmentally friendly system eliminates the need for hazardous solvents, ensuring a safe and rapid testing process for quality control in road construction and research environments. By utilizing an automated ignition process, it delivers highly repeatable results that comply with international testing standards.
